Overview

The SolaHD HS10F10AS is a 10 kVA, single-phase, non-ventilated automation transformer designed for reliable power conversion in industrial automation and control systems. This unit features a 600 V primary voltage and offers a dual secondary voltage output of 120 V or 240 V, providing flexibility for various equipment requirements. The primary current rating is 16.7 A, with secondary current capabilities of 83.3 A at 120 V or 41.7 A at 240 V. Operating at a standard 60 Hz frequency, the HS10F10AS ensures compatibility with common power grids. Its non-ventilated design contributes to a smaller footprint, reducing installation space requirements and minimizing maintenance needs, making it suitable for high-density automation environments. Manufactured in the US by SolaHD, this transformer is built for durability and precise voltage regulation, offering an energy-efficient solution for powering industrial control panels, process equipment, and other automation machinery. How should the electrostatic shield be connected?

The electrostatic shield should be connected to the equipment ground (green) or to both the equipment ground and the system ground (white).

What certifications does the HS10F10AS hold?

The HS10F10AS is UL Listed (E25872, E77014), CSA C22.2 No. 47 or No. 66, and RoHS Compliant.

What type of enclosure does the HS10F10AS use?

The HS10F10AS uses a UL Listed/NEMA Type 3R encapsulated enclosure, suitable for indoor and outdoor service.

Is the HS10F10AS transformer electrostatically shielded?

Yes, the HS10F10AS is electrostatically shielded for quality power, as it is 1 kVA or larger.

What insulation system does the HS10F10AS use?

The HS10F10AS uses a UL Class 200˚C insulation system, with a 115˚C temperature rise under full load.
